Brianaria sylvicola

Brianaria sylvicola is a species of saxicolous lichen in the family Psoraceae.

The species was first named Lecidea sylvicola by Julius von Flotow in 1829.

In 2014, Stefan Ekman and Måns Svensson circumscribed the genus Brianaria to contain four closely related species formerly in the Micarea sylvicola group, and made Brianaria sylvicola the type species.
